Transaction 89616362fcdb91fb8bd96cfedc0fd8e98a25bedb77b7d96091e0b647852d1d2e
1 Input
1 Output
-
89616362fcdb91fb8bd96cfedc0fd8e98a25bedb77b7d96091e0b647852d1d2e:0
- value
- 60197
- script pubkey
- OP_0 OP_PUSHBYTES_20 362c5052b9acf5e0af8c2bab2d22fe6190bc3efa
- address
- bc1qxck9q54e4n67ptuv9w4j6gh7vxgtc0h6s3djew